Le Mystérieux Orchestre Électronique de Paris

In 2020, Le Mystérieux Orchestre Électronique de Paris began recording pieces of Furniture Music for activities requiring concentration or simply for relaxation. The Orchestra uses generative music processes. Electronic tools are considered interpreters, bona fide members of the ensemble. Analog synths are used along with composition software. Julia Bünnagel

Julia Bünnagel is a contemporary sound and sculpting artist based in Cologne. Her live performances primarily use modified vinyl records that produce sounds unlike anything else. Ibrahim Alfa Jr

Ibrahim Alfa Jnr is a British-Nigerian producer, performer, and label founder whose adventurous career in electronic music spans nearly three decades. Raised on piano, guitar, and early computer experiments, Alfa was inspired by the minimalism of Steve Reich and John Cage, as well as the emerging sounds of acid house and Detroit techno. Gilb’R

Gilb’r, real name Gilbert Cohen, is a key figure in French underground electronic music. He started out his career in music in the 90s as a programmer at Radio Nova in Paris and founded Versatile Records in 1996. Versatile is still a household name within underground club music and more.
